快速回顧 1980 年代微軟的 IBM PC 附加卡
幾個月前,我寫了一篇關於微軟幾乎被人遺忘的第一款硬件產品——Apple II 的 SoftCard 附加板的文章。它於 1980 年 4 月首次推出。事實證明,這張卡對公司來說非常成功。當IBM PC 遊戲於 1981 年 8 月問世時,它包含一個 Microsoft BASIC 版本。因此,該公司很自然地決定看看是否可以用為 IBM PC 製造的產品複製 Apple II SoftCard 的成功。
1982 年,Microsoft 發布了用於 IBM PC 的 RAM Card。據PC Magazine 報導,它不僅可以讓用戶將 IBM 個人電腦上的可用 RAM 從 64K 一直擴展到 256K,還可以讓用戶訪問其 RAMDrive。使用此功能,您可以將部分板載 RAM 設置為充當存儲磁盤,以便更快地訪問數據。基本上,這就是今天的 SSD。
不幸的是,在互聯網上搜索該板的實際圖像並沒有成功,不過如果有的話我會更新這篇文章。
1983 年,Microsoft 更進一步推出了用於 IBM PC 的 SystemCard。您仍然可以使用它來將 PC 的內存擴展到 256Kb。但是,它也可以做很多其他事情。當您將基於 ISA 的卡插入 IBM PC 時,它還用作打印機接口和假脫機程序。該卡甚至有自己的日曆和時鐘芯片。
1984 年,微軟為新的 IBM PCjr 計算機推出了類似的 RAM 增強卡,稱為 PCJr Booster。微軟甚至將其早期鼠標產品之一包含在這張卡中。同樣,我無法在網上找到這張卡片的圖片。
1985 年,微軟發布了 Windows 1.0 版,最終成為其標誌性產品。然而,壞消息是許多 IBM PC 的速度不夠快,無法很好地運行操作系統。他們內部裝有 Intel 的 8088 CPU,但以 4.77 MHz 的時鐘速度運行。1986 年,Microsoft 發布了 Mach 10,這是 IBM PC 和一些 IBM 克隆 PC 的主板附加組件。它有一個 Intel 8086 CPU 版本,時鐘速度快得多,達到 9.54MHz。它甚至包括一個鼠標端口。
然而,根據微軟高級軟件工程師 Raymond Chen的博客文章,Mach 10 開發板是“失敗的”。微軟再次嘗試使用 Mach 20 開發板。陳說:
Mach 20 採用了與 Mach 10 相同的基本理念,但更上一層樓:和以前一樣,您拔下舊的 4.77 MHz 8088 CPU 並將其替換為一個適配器,該適配器通過帶狀電纜連接到您插入的 Mach 20 卡入擴展槽。這一次,Mach 20 有一個 8 MHz 80286 CPU,所以你現在真的是在用煤氣做飯。而且,和 Mach 10 一樣,它有一個內置的鼠標端口。
Microsoft Mach 20 還有子板,可用於將 PC 的內存擴展至 3.5MB。處理器和內存的增加都允許帶有此主板的 PC 在標準模式下運行 Windows 2.0。它還允許 PC 連接到 5.25 英寸或 3.5 英寸軟盤驅動器。
Mach 20 於 1988 年以 495 美元的價格上市銷售,但據 Chen 稱,“它的銷量比 Mach 10 好,但話又說回來,這並沒有說明什麼。”事實上,Mach 20 將是微軟最後一款 PC 附加卡銷售,因為它轉向其他硬件配件,如鍵盤、鼠標和操縱桿等。
Chen 的博客中有一個有趣的附註是,Microsoft 實際上創建了 IBM 自己的 O/S 2 的自定義版本以在 Mach 20 上運行。但是,運行該版本的操作系統仍然會導致許多性能問題,Chen 聲稱,根據一位不願透露姓名的前僱員,它可能是微軟歷史上銷量最低的軟件產品:
根據那個人的記憶(考慮到已經過去的時間,這意味著我們此時基本上應該說“根據傳說”),總共售出了 11 份“OS/2 for Mach 20”,其中八人被歸還。
當然,Microsoft 的 PC 附加組件時代已經結束了幾十年,但回顧個人計算機行業這個特定的早期時代仍然令人著迷。
發佈留言